Hospitality available for WF patients and their families

Wed, 02/10/2021 - 5:00 am

Your family member is sick and you’re going to be spending a lot of time in the Wichita Falls area. The question then becomes where are you going to stay. Families under a lot of stress already can stay for a much lower rate than a hotel and be in close proximity to United Regional Medical Center.

The Rathgeber Hospitality House is across the street from United and can be used by anyone with family at a hospital in the area.The facility has been vopen for 20 years, and has prices of 20 years ago at just $40 a night according to Executive Director Kim Tomlinson, who spoke to Jacksboro Lions Club members recently.The facility has 26 guest rooms, so there is usually always an opening. Someone is always there 24-7-365 to answer questions or to register folks. Tonlinson said each room has a queen bed and a sleeper sofa with a community kitchen to save money and help families who want to stay close to the scene in these COVID times.

In other news, Lion Joe Mitchell inquired about getting the Handy Lion program started once again. Mitchell said Concerned Citizens of Jack County will be the main contact point to have work done. Lions will request to work on the team and when a request comes in the team will be contacted to see who wants perform the task.

Small tasks would ideally be done within 24 hours with larger projects requiring approval from the committee.

“These large project may be out of our scope of abilities, or we may be able to coordinate with other organizations to get them completed,” Mitchell said in an email.
